Lawn Herbicide Treatment in Aiken, SC
Lawn herbicide treatment services involve the targeted application of herbicides to control and eliminate unwanted weeds and invasive plants in residential lawns. These treatments are suitable for a variety of projects, including clearing out broadleaf weeds, crabgrass, dandelions, clover, and other common lawn invaders. Proper herbicide application can help maintain a healthy, uniform, and attractive lawn by reducing competition for nutrients and water, promoting the growth of desirable grass species.
Property owners interested in herbicide treatments should understand the importance of identifying specific weed types present on their lawn, as different weeds may require different treatment approaches. It’s also helpful to consider the timing of applications to maximize effectiveness, typically during active growth periods for weeds. Before requesting a service, homeowners often want to know about the potential impact on surrounding plants, pets, and children, as well as any necessary follow-up treatments to achieve long-term weed control.

Common Lawn Herbicide Treatment Jobs
Herbicide applications - targeted treatments to control broadleaf weeds in lawns.
Pre-emergent treatments - prevent weed seeds from germinating and establishing.
Post-emergent weed control - eliminate existing weeds without harming the grass.
Seasonal weed management - tailored plans to keep lawns weed-free throughout the year.
Spot treatments - precise application for isolated weed problems.
Lawn health enhancement - improve overall grass vigor to reduce weed invasions.
Lawn Herbicide Treatment Questions
What types of weeds can herbicide treatments target? Herbicide treatments can effectively control common weeds like crabgrass, dandelions, and clover in lawns.
When is the best time to apply lawn herbicide? The optimal time for application depends on the weed type and growth stage, often during active growth periods in spring or fall.
Are herbicide treatments safe for pets and children? Herbicide products are formulated to minimize risks, but it's recommended to keep pets and children off treated areas until dry.
How often should herbicide treatments be applied? The frequency varies based on weed issues and lawn conditions, typically requiring follow-up applications for ongoing control.
